TikTok Shop美区发布新规:买家责任退货运费改由商家全额承担

【亿邦原创】5月9日消息,TikTok Shop日前向美国市场商家发布最新政策公告,宣布将于2026年6月起调整平台退货费用承担机制。根据新规,凡因消费者个人原因发起的退货,包括“不再需要”“尺码不合适”等情形,其退货过程中产生的全部物流费用,将统一由商家承担。

这意味着,在新规正式实施后,针对买家责任类退货,商品从消费者地址寄回至平台退货仓或商家美国海外仓所涉及的境内运费,不再由平台或消费者分摊,而将全部计入卖家经营成本;消费者选择自行安排退货物流方式时,仍由买家承担运费。

相比此前相对灵活的费用分担模式,此次调整进一步明确了商家在退货链路中的责任边界。

对于平台而言,此举被解释为一种“提升定价自主权”的运营思路。TikTok Shop方面表示,商家未来可以将潜在退货运费提前纳入商品定价体系之中,从而更清晰地管理整体经营成本,并增强利润测算的确定性。

不过,从卖家实际经营角度来看,新规对利润空间的影响或将较为直接。

行业媒体进行了测算,以美国市场常见的跨境女装业务为例,若一件售价30美元的商品采用中国主体结合美国海外仓备货模式销售,当消费者因尺码不合适申请退货时,商家通常需承担3至6美元不等的美国境内逆向物流费用。

在毛利率约30%的情况下,该商品单笔订单的毛利润约为9美元。若发生一次退货,仅退货运费便可能吞噬掉超过半数利润,极端情况下甚至接近整单利润水平。对于利润率本就有限的跨境商家而言,退货成本的重要性将进一步上升。

尤其是在服饰、鞋靴等高退货率品类中,退货率长期维持在15%至25%并不罕见。随着新规落地,退货率将与卖家的固定运营成本更加直接挂钩,逆向物流费用也可能从过去的偶发性支出,逐渐演变为可长期量化的经营负担。

在宣布费用调整的同时,TikTok Shop也同步推出两项配套措施,以缓解商家对成本压力上升的担忧。

首先,平台将上线“全链路经营成本可视化”服务。该功能将帮助商家更清晰地查看退货费用构成,包括物流、仓储及售后等环节的具体支出情况,并通过数据反馈优化商品详情页、包装质量以及履约体验,从而降低因信息偏差或商品体验问题带来的退货率。

其次,平台还计划推出可选型“商家保障险”。根据官方描述,该保险工具主要用于对冲退货成本异常波动风险,帮助商家在大促活动、季节性消费波动等特殊时期,减轻集中退货对现金流和利润稳定性的冲击。

业内普遍认为,此次调整不仅意味着TikTok Shop美区退货责任结构的进一步重塑,也反映出平台正在推动退货体系从“平台补贴型”向“商家自担型”转变。

与此同时,配套的数据化管理与保险机制,则显示平台希望建立一套“成本可测算、风险可管理”的退货运营体系,而并非单纯将退货压力直接转嫁给卖家。
